Pubs: the waverly, just off the royal mile and the cumberland in the new town are my personal favourites. The galleries are all good really, especial reccomendations are the National Gallery of Scotland, the Museum of Modern art and the Fruitmarket Gallery. Clubs in edinburgh tend to be a bit dodgy. Places that aren't terrible all the time are Cabaret Voltaire and the Bongo club, clubbing isn't well catered for here. I don't really eat out much when I'm home so can't help you there. Underground Solution on Cockburn Street, also just off the royal mile is the best place for record shopping apart from Fopp, which is on Rose Street, just behind Jenners.
